In the uproarious 1973 comedy Holiday on the Buses, the misadventures of the beloved characters from the classic British series continue in a new and chaotic setting. After a rather embarrassing incident involving a female passenger and a bus crash, Stan and Jack find themselves jobless, alongside their nemesis, Blakey. However, the trio's paths cross again when Stan and Jack land new jobs as a bus crew at a lively Pontins holiday resort. The sun-soaked fun quickly turns sour as they discover that Blakey, now the resort's chief security guard, is lurking around, determined to make their lives miserable.
